Moncada Barracks in Cuba, 1986
Santiago de Cuba, Cuba. In 1953, Moncada Barracks were attacked by a group of rebels, led by Fidel Castro. The attack became the starting point of Cuban struggle against dictator Fulgencio Batista. Semyon Maisterman/TASS
